Here are five common tips that we offer: 1-Regular Maintenance: Regularly inspect and maintain your plumbing system to catch potential issues early on. This includes checking for leaks, inspecting faucets and pipes, and ensuring proper drainage. 2-Avoid Chemical Drain Cleaners: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es over time and may not effectively resolve clogs. Instead, use non-toxic methods like a plunger or a drain snake to clear clogs. 3-Preventative Measures: Take preventative measures to avoid common plumbing problems. For example, insulate pipes during colder months to prevent freezing and bursting, and avoid pouring grease or coffee grounds down drains to prevent clogs. 4-Know Your Shut-off Valve: Locate and familiarize yourself with the main shut-off valve for your home's water supply. In case of a plumbing emergency, such as a burst pipe, shutting off the water quickly can help minimize damage. 5-Call a Professional: While DIY plumbing fixes can be tempting, it's often best to call a professional plumber for complex issues or repairs. Attempting repairs without the proper knowledge or tools can potentially make the problem worse and result in costly damage.
